Criticism and Worries Faced by Dr. Muhammad Yunus



Dr. Muhammad Yunus, the Nobel Peace Prize laureate and founder of Grameen Bank, has long been a pivotal figure in the microfinance movement, advocating for innovative alternatives to poverty alleviation. Even so, his operate has not been devoid of criticism and difficulties.

Detractors argue that though microcredit has empowered lots of men and women, it's got also resulted in unintended consequences, like above-indebtedness amongst borrowers. Critics contend that the large-interest fees linked to microloans can lure the really folks they intention to help inside of a cycle of credit card debt, undermining the Original ambitions of financial inclusion and financial empowerment. What's more, Yunus's approach has confronted scrutiny regarding its scalability and sustainability.

Some economists argue that microfinance just isn't a panacea for poverty Which it could divert awareness from a lot more systemic troubles which include insufficient infrastructure, lack of education and learning, and inadequate healthcare. This viewpoint suggests that even though microcredit can offer temporary aid, it doesn't handle the foundation brings about of poverty. Due to this fact, Yunus's vision of social organization and microfinance has sparked a broader debate with regards to the performance of marketplace-dependent alternatives in addressing elaborate social challenges.


The political landscape bordering Dr. Muhammad Yunus has long been fraught with stress, specifically in Bangladesh, where his initiatives have occasionally clashed with governmental interests. Critics have accused him of remaining overly formidable and of aiming to wield affect further than his function as a social entrepreneur.

Grameen Bank, Irrespective of its pioneering function in microfinance, has encountered various economic problems which have examined its operational design. One important issue may be the sustainability of its lending methods within an ever more aggressive financial landscape. As extra establishments enter the microfinance sector, Grameen Lender faces stress to maintain its interest charges even though making certain that it may possibly protect operational expenditures and keep on to offer financial loans to its borrowers.

This balancing act is very important with the lender's long-expression viability and its capacity to serve the poorest segments of society. In addition, fluctuations in the global financial system can effects Grameen Lender's functions. Economic downturns may result in increased default prices among the borrowers, specifically those engaged in vulnerable sectors such as agriculture or compact-scale manufacturing.

The financial institution's reliance on group lending versions, which encourage peer assist and accountability, is probably not ample to mitigate pitfalls all through economic crises. Therefore, Grameen Financial institution should continuously adapt its methods to navigate these economic worries while remaining devoted to its mission of poverty alleviation.


Dr. Muhammad Yunus has confronted a series of authorized challenges which have raised questions on governance and accountability within just Grameen Financial institution. In 2010, he was embroiled in the authorized dispute With all the Bangladeshi government over allegations of mismanagement and fiscal irregularities within the financial institution.

This legal natural environment poses ongoing issues for Yunus and Grameen Financial institution as they navigate compliance while striving to fulfill their mission of empowering the weak by means of monetary services.

Ethical Concerns in Microcredit and Poverty Alleviation


The microcredit model championed by Dr. Muhammad Yunus has sparked moral debates concerning its impact on poverty alleviation. Although proponents argue that microloans provide critical funds for entrepreneurship amongst minimal-money men and women, critics spotlight prospective moral dilemmas affiliated with superior-fascination rates and intense repayment methods.

Some borrowers have described feeling pressured to repay financial loans even though their firms fail or whenever they encounter personal hardships, raising questions about the moral implications of profit-pushed lending in susceptible communities. Also, you can find issues concerning the prospective for exploitation inside the microfinance sector. Scenarios of predatory lending methods have emerged, in which borrowers are billed exorbitant curiosity fees that can result in financial distress rather than empowerment.

This moral quandary underscores the need for higher regulation and oversight throughout the microfinance sector to make sure that it serves its intended purpose with out compromising the well-currently being of People it aims that can help.
